This movie was pretty enjoyable. You can definitely tell the parts where Cera must have gone in and rewritten his lines in the screenplay, to tailor them more to his voice and to what he does best. For those that criticize him for playing the same character over and over again, it's nice to see him stretching out, playing 3 characters in this (yes, 3...I'll let the other one be a surprise). The movie starts off a little better than it ends up finishing, but overall it's better than its January release date would indicate. Its sensibilities are more in tune with Artera's previous work ("Chuck and Buck", "The Good Girl") than with something like "Superbad". Zach's part is very small.
